Intermediate Apprenticeship in Health and Social Care (Adults).

UPDATED 20160411 07:50:51

Courses in Health and Social Care provide people with a clear career progression and a qualification which is based on providing person centred care which fulfils all requirements of the law. For the Intermediate Appreticeship in Health and Social Care you will undertake the following qualifications: Diploma in Health and Social Care Level 2 Certificate in Preparing to work in the Health and Social Care Sector. The Employers Rights and Responsibilities workbook. Depending on your prior qualifications you may also need to do the fuctional skills certificates in English and Maths.
